James Aiken Obituary

HAW RIVER - Mr. James Edgar "Jim" Aiken Sr., 86, died at 2:45 a.m. Thursday, Dec. 18, 2014, at the Hospice Home of Burlington after five years of failing health and two weeks critical illness.
Born in Guilford County, he was to the son of the late Guy and Ethel Russell Aiken, a U.S. Army veteran, retired from Annedeen Hosiery and a lifetime member of the Hillsborough Moose Lodge.
Family members surviving him are his wife of 46 years, Linda Lankford Aiken, of the home; sons, James E. "Jimmy" Aiken and wife Juanita and James W. "Buster" Aiken and wife Trudy; daughters, Gail Sharpe, Clara Gurkin and Katrina Rickman, all of Burlington; 11 grandchildren; 11 great-grandchildren; two great-great-grandchildren; sister, Helen Thompson of Savannah, Ga.; and a host of nieces and nephews.
He was preceded in death by nine brothers and sisters.
The family will receive friends on Saturday evening, Dec. 20, 2014, at the McClure Funeral and Cremation Service in Graham from 6 until 8 and at other times at the home.
Funeral Services will be held at 2 p.m. Sunday, Dec. 21, 2014, in the McClure Chapel officiated by Pastor Tim Thornton. Burial will follow in the Graham Memorial Park with Military Rites.
The family requests memorials be made to the Hospice Home of Burlington, 918 Chapel Hill Road, Burlington, NC 27215.
